Imran Khan rules out any deal, says Barrister Gohar
Share on WhatAppShare on XShare on Facebook

Rawalpindi, April 15, 2025: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) Chairman Barrister Gohar has firmly stated that party founder Imran Khan has rejected the idea of entering into any kind of deal, dispelling speculation about behind-the-scenes negotiations.

Speaking to the media outside Adiala Jail following a legal meeting with Imran Khan, Barrister Gohar clarified that the former prime minister has neither authorised any individual to speak on his behalf nor permitted any negotiations.

“There are no talks, and no one has been authorised to initiate any dialogue,” Gohar said, quoting Khan during the lawyers’ meeting, which included five members of his legal team.

Gohar also confirmed that once again, Khan’s family — including his sisters — was not allowed to meet him. “This is a clear violation and amounts to contempt of court,” he said, pointing to repeated obstructions in family visitation rights.

The denial follows earlier reports of Khan’s sisters being stopped at the jail checkpoint, sparking a roadside protest led by his sister Aleema Khan.

Barrister Gohar further relayed Khan’s concern over recent acts of terrorism in the country. “He expressed sorrow over the tragic incidents and condemned all forms of violence,” Gohar said.

Reiterating the party’s stance, he dismissed all talk of ongoing negotiations as fabricated. “There is no deal. Imran Khan remains steadfast on his principles,” Gohar concluded.
